## Authentication

Deep-link routing in the Skylark mobile app resolves incoming links through the Wayfarer resolution service before handing them to the in-app router. Every resolution call must be authenticated; unauthenticated requests are dropped silently, which on-call often sees as "links open to the home screen." If that happens, verify the resolver credential first before touching routing tables. The staging resolver uses its own credential, rotated quarterly. The current staging key is shown below.

app token of bahaf-tajeg = zpat23_SjjsllwiLmXbtS65veZaV47

Finance Review Summary — Next Year's Headcount

Quick read for branch managers: headcount grows a modest 4 percent next year, weighted toward service roles at the Kettlewick and Ashbourne Fen branches. Backfills are pre-approved; new roles need regional sign-off. Hiring opens after the January close. The confidential note on business plans sits just below.

board note of bajop-yaweg: The western region missed its Pelys quota by 58.0 percent last quarter. Pelysek Foods plans to raise the Belius list price by 44.0 percent in July. The steering committee signed off on a budget of $133.8 million for Project Pelax. The renewal with Zoraelix Systems closes at $61.9 million a year, 12.7 percent above the last contract.

Runbook 4.2 — Kiosk watchdog account recovery (Bramleigh Transit kiosks). If the Ostrel watchdog loses its service account after a factory reset, the kiosk loops on the boot screen. Do not reimage. Instead, connect over the maintenance port, stop the watchdog, and run the re-enrollment tool from the contractor laptop. The tool asks you to confirm the kiosk serial, then prompts for credential restore. At that prompt, enter the recovery passphrase, which is:

unlock words, kajef-kadug: sorys-pelax-lamael-tamvan-briiel-novdor-fenwyn-tamdor-oliion-keleth-julok-belion-ralok

Subject: DR drill — deep-link routing

Welcome aboard. Next Wednesday we run a disaster-recovery drill for Routerel, the deep-link routing layer behind the Marbeck app. You'll help verify that links resolve correctly once we fail over to the standby resolver. No prep needed beyond reading the runbook. To unlock the standby resolver console, enter the recovery passphrase provided below.

unlock words, yawig-kagef: gordor-holvan-ulaael-pramir-ulaiel-tamdor